Hi, new member here. Just got a 650. Can anyone tell me if there is a way to download MIDI files (ringtones) from my PC to my 650 through my hotsync cable. My PC is not bluetooth enabled nor do I have email/internet access through my 650. thanks. Masi

PilotInstall (http://envicon.de/e/pinstall/pinstall.html), Palm File Browser, a couple of applications to look at. PilotInstall is the easier to use. However, due to memory constraints, I would not recommend adding them.
